About this course
Succeeding in competitive civil engineering exams requires a rock-solid grasp of fluid mechanics and hydraulic structures. This comprehensive text-based course breaks down complex hydraulic concepts into clear, manageable explanations designed for exam success. You will start with the absolute fundamentals of fluid behavior in open channels before moving on to practical calculations and engineering applications.
By working through detailed written explanations, step-by-step mathematical derivations, and targeted practice problems, you will develop the analytical skills needed to solve challenging hydraulic questions with precision.
What you'll learn:
- Understand foundational open channel flow terminology, geometric elements, and velocity distributions
- Apply Manning's and Chezy's equations to solve steady, uniform flow problems
- Analyze specific energy, critical depth, and transition controls in rectangular and non-rectangular channels
- Calculate gradually varied flow profiles using modern numerical integration and direct integration methods
- Evaluate rapidly varied flow phenomena including hydraulic jumps, energy dissipation, and surge analysis
- Practice solving exam-style civil engineering questions with comprehensive written solutions
This course begins with essential definitions and fluid properties, gradually building up to advanced water surface profiles and energy transitions. It is designed specifically for civil engineering students and exam aspirants looking for a clear, conceptual path to mastery.
